Sizes: One Size

Finished Dimensions: circumference – 18 inches / 46 cm, height – 9.25 inches / 23.5 cm

Yarn: Dream in Color Yarn Classy Worsted, 100% Superwash Merino, 250 yards/ 4 oz

Yardage: 150 yards/ 137 meters

Gauge: 20 stitches and 28 rows = 4 inches/10 cm in reverse stockinette on size 7 needles

Needles: US 6/ 4 mm and US 7/4.5 mm

Notions: Stitch markers, cable needles, and darning needle for weaving in ends.

Notes: Hat is worked from the bottom up in the round beginning with a twisted rib brim and finished with easy alternating cable and texture sections. Pattern can be worked from either charted or written instructions.
